Workarounds: Known issues in IBM Rational Quality Manager 4.0.5

The following known problems are related to the Rational Quality Manager 4.0.5 release.

Workarounds

The following problems in this release have workarounds:


Workaround summary

Problem

In Rational Quality Manager 4.0.5, the “Require actual results on steps” server-level setting is replaced by the “Require an Actual Result for Script Steps” precondition. With that precondition, you can define a process to require actual results for failed steps only, for blocked steps only, or for all of the step results.

Workaround

To use the “Require an Actual Result for Script Steps” precondition, follow the steps in the Defining a precondition to mandate actual results in a manual test script help topic.

Problem

When you try to download a file by using Internet Explorer, the download might fail with an error message. This problem occurs on Internet Explorer only.

For example, on the Manage Export Queue page, if you try to download a CSV or PDF file, the suggested file name might be download?uuid=_1KPWUCw2EeOfBJpaQkqO-g. Then, if you try to download the file, the download fails. On Internet Explorer 9, this problem is caused by the “Do not save encrypted pages to disk” setting.

Workaround

Complete these steps:

  1. In Internet Explorer, click Tools > Internet Options, and then click the Advanced tab.
  2. Scroll to the Security section. Find the Do not save encrypted pages to disk check box and clear it. Click OK.

Problem

This problem occurs in the Test Cases list view and in the Test Cases section of a test plan. The link in the test script column incorrectly points to the test plan that uses the test script ID. If you click the link, you might see a “test plan not found” error or open an irrelevant test plan that happens to have the same ID as the test script.

Workaround

Complete these steps:

  1. Hover over the test script link, but do not click it.
  2. In the rich hover that opens, click the title of the test script. That link is a valid link to the test script.

Problem

If you have a large number of test cases, such as over 500, the following method of generating test case execution records does not work reliably:

  1. Browse to Planning > Create test plan.
  2. In the Test Cases section, add a large number of test cases (for example, 1000), and save the test plan.
  3. Select all the test cases and generate test case execution records.

Workaround

Complete the steps for the application server that you use.

IBM WebSphere Application Server

  1. Stop the CLM/QM server.
  2. Set the system property as follows: maxParamPerRequest="1000000". For details about setting the system property, see Set up system property.
  3. Start the CLM/QM server.

Apache Tomcat

  1. Stop the CLM/QM server.
  2. Set the attribute on the Connector tag of the Server.xml file as follows: maxParameterCount="1000000". For details about setting the attribute, see Set connector attribute.
  3. Start the CLM/QM server.

Problem

If you create two or more values with the same name for different category types, and those two category types are part of the same hierarchy branch, when you save, the lowest hierarchy value is not assigned to any parent value.

Workaround

Complete one of the following workarounds:

Workaround 1
1. If you have two values with the same name, first save the hierarchy of the first value.
2. After you save the first value, save the second value in a separate operation.

Workaround 2
Use the hierarchy view to create your hierarchy.
